My Students

"Why does an underground railroad have no trains?" It's a concept that can confuse the most literal of U.S. born, native English speakers, and truly stump a recently immigrated English Language Learner. Enter 7th-grade history, if you dare!

My ELL, English Language Learner students, are energetic, young pre-teens, who come from a range of immigrant experiences, and cultural backgrounds.

Each day, they struggle to express themselves fully in a second language, and can get overwhelmed by this great challenge. Growing up outside of the U.S., or even densely packed immigrant communities here within the country, many of my students arrive with little background knowledge, on the basics of American history, and the culture that has been shaped by it. So, when they jump into social studies, they're learning what feels like encyclopedic amounts of events, and important figures, for the first time. When they reach ELA, they're lost in the historical context of period-specific literary texts, and get tripped up by the terms and phrases, such as "fare thee well," "hornbook," and "canteen". The mind can only process so much.

My Project

Gathering a store of curriculum-relevant young readers editions and picture books, of early American people and eras, as well as bilingual copies of core texts, like Lord of the Flies, will reduce the fog my 7th and 8th-grade students enter, in their increasingly challenging Social Studies and ELA classes. The simpler sentence structures and vocabulary will help my ELLs grow the language foundations they need, for everyday life and other classes. They can then, also, build a visual context, necessary to really grasp the fundamentals of these time periods, and start to understand the origins of allusions and idioms, they might come across today, such as "learning the ropes," and even "mind your own bee's wax"!

So often my students are overwhelmed playing catch-up with their peers, because of their limited English proficiency.

This project helps bridge that gap, and provides them with essential background knowledge, that allows them to participate fairly in class discussions and projects, without being totally lost. Being able to keep pace with their peers, encourages them on their difficult journey of mastering English, and can free them up to have some fun along the way!
